At The Thirsty Scholar you can be sure to find a warm friendly welcome and comfortable accommodation. There’s traditional local ales and ciders behind the bar, delicious lunches and suppers every day, a large sheltered beer garden and an open fire.
The menu consists entirely of home-cooked, fresh produce which they source locally. It will vary and each weekend there are additional seasonal specials available. Their commitment to providing carefully prepared, high quality food and exceptional value has ensured a growing reputation amongst locals and visitors alike.
The pub’s freshly decorated en-suite bed and breakfast rooms are warm and welcoming, with free WiFi, TV, tea and coffee making facilities and hair dryers. Guests also enjoy the use of a private terrace in the garden with views to the river, for lunch and evening meals. Private, off road parking close to Tremough Campus is available for guests.
The large, sheltered garden has a spacious covered area and enjoys views of the river towards Falmouth and the sea. The quaint and picturesque single track railway line that connects Penryn with Truro and Falmouth is just a five minute walk away. Cooked English breakfast is served between 8am and 9.30am; and a continental alternative is available for early risers, meanwhile pets are welcome by arrangement.
